Podstawy Pythona: Jak pisać testy?

preview_player
Показать описание

Jeżeli nie czujesz potrzeby pisania testów albo nie wiesz o co w tym wszystkim chodzi, to znak że coś należy zmienić i dowiedzieć się jak zacząć!

Ten film to tylko wstęp do testowania, wierzchołek kamienistej drogi, ale dzięki testom jednostkowym możemy spać dużo spokojniej. Nie musimy martwić się czy nasz kod działa, bo testy nas o tym upewniają.

W filmie za pomocą biblioteki pytest pokazuje jak napisać Twój pierwszy test, następnie jak przetestować wyświetlany przez funkcję komunikat, jak tworzyć klasy testowe oraz jak przetestować czy funkcja poprawnie zwróciła wyjątek.

Zapraszam!
Рекомендации по теме
Комментарии
Автор

Świetny totorial. Zgodnie z rekomendacją pod koniec odcinka, proszę o więcej na temat testów w pythonie :D

jakubbanaszkiewicz
Автор

Ale świetny tutorial 👍 Poproszę więcej. Odcinki do 40min, ale z taką dawką wiedzy są idealne.

krzysiekkrzysiek
Автор

Najlepszy materiał dla poczatkujacych o testowaniu, jaki do tej pory oglądałem

JRJRJR
Автор

Super Filmiki ;) ... Oglądanie od A do Z to podstawa :) ... Oby więcej i by motywacja była dalej ;) Pozdrawiam Serdecznie :)

TomaszTom-tvik
Автор

Właśnie zainteresowałem się tematem testów, szkoda że tak mało na kanale.

Swoją drogą, moim zdaniem im dłuższe takie tutki tym lepsze, zawsze jest się w stanie wyciągnąć coś dla siebie a gdy materiał dłuższy to i więcej można się nauczyć :)

Pozdrawiam

mateuszdelfin
Автор

Super :D Dobrze, że wpadłem na Twój kanał. Podpisuję się pod prośbą o więcej filmików o testach :)
Dobrze się słucha i ogląda. Wszystko jasne :D
Pozdrawiam :)

mariuszrogawski
Автор

Tak fajnie byłoby dowiedzieć się czegoś więcej o testach

Sandra-pvev
Автор

Świetny film Panie Kacprze! Przerabiam książkę Python instrukcje dla programisty i Twoje filmy są super uzupełnieniem. Przekazujesz wiedzę jest prosty i klarowny sposób. 40 minut a odczułem jakby to było wspomniane 15 ;) pozdrawiam i liczę na więcej materiałów na tym kanale!

herbacianyzero
Автор

Twoje filmy są super! Nie rozumiem jak można oglądać tylko 5 min... może zapowiedź na początku kolejnego że w środku filmiku ukryty jest konkurs ;) ?
Byłoby super gdybyś zrobił bardziej zaawansowany kurs pytest'a, akurat muszę się go nauczyć do pracy :)
Pozdrawiam i idę do kolejnego filmiku!

Bartoszeg
Автор

Odkładałem ten filmik z testami ile się tylko dało, a poszło ku mojemu zdziwieniu całkiem dobrze.

andrzejmacieja
Автор

To nie jest tak, że mało kto wytrzymuje do końca, tylko tak jak np. u mnie wygląda to tak, że dawkuje sobie wiedzę stopniowo, najwyżej zrobię to na części. Czyli w jeden dzień połowa filmu razem z pycharmem, a w drugi dzień reszta 👍

astronom
Автор

Kacper, nie cierpię tutoriali krótkich i bez sensu (na sensowne tematy, bo widziałem 15-minutowy jak wymienić baterię w pilocie), nie martw się czasem. Keep up the good work!

michalmorawski
Автор

🐍Zapisz się do newsletter'a i zacznij programować!

KacperSieradziński
Автор

Elegancja Francja! Pozdrawiam i dziękuję :D

riskzerobeatz
Автор

jest szansa na więcej filmików z testowania? <3 <3

MrPoz
Автор

Jestem cierpliwy ;) A programista powinien być cierpliwy :-D Ciekawe czy mi się kiedyś uda ;)

adamnowak
Автор

Nie wiem czy dobrze rozumiem. W przypadku sprawdzenia pełnoletności po prostu odpalam program, wprowadzam wiek i mi zwraca - jesteś pełnoletni, albo nie jesteś pełnoletni. Dzięki temu wiem czy działa. Natomiast domyślam się, że testy przydają się przy bardziej rozbudowanych kodach o czym wspominałeś. Ale i tak trudno mi to sobie wyobrazić bo przecież na podobnej zasadzie mogę je sprawdzić - w sensie uruchomić, podać wartości i zobaczyć czy zwraca co trzeba. Chyba, że chodzi o to - jak np. przy tej niepełnoletności - mogę te różne wartości podać za jednym zamachem. Tak musiałbym każdorazowo odpalać program i sprawdzać kolejno jak się zachowa przy 3, jak się zachowa przy 17, jak się zachowa przy... A tutaj jedno uruchomienie i mam sprawdzone wszystko.

adamnowak
Автор

Ja dotrwałem do końca. Dobrze się oglądało ! :)

mechlopak
Автор

Genialny filmik, nareszcie jakiś tutorial, który prosto, a sensownie pokazuje testowanie. Uczę się programować tak praktycznie od roku i od jakiegoś czasu chciałem zacząć testować te moje półprodukty 🙂😉, ale zawsze temat testów był dla mnie za skomplikowany. Teraz mogę zacząć...
I nie wiem, czemu w filmie pada stwierdzenie, że jest za długi. Jak dla mnie jest za krótki 😆

stefan.ocetkiewicz
Автор

Czy w testach zawsze trzeba komentować "then, given, when"? Jest to dobra praktyka czy tutaj tak tylko w celach edukacyjnych?

MrBrightsideTK